Output 2af90437c48945c1332b03bf2965601a50b4b27d091720f569f209556effaeae:0

value
2990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 127d61f9976975723f505b54a70207214764287c OP_EQUAL
address
M9avbdK5f9Zz7s5sq18upZ8UQwyK6mYu9h
transaction
2af90437c48945c1332b03bf2965601a50b4b27d091720f569f209556effaeae
spent
true